For ventilation on aircrafts to be safe and efficient, industrial ducting that can withstand constantly changing air pressures, temperatures and weather conditions. This is why flexible ducting made of advanced materials such as polyurethane, polyethylene and polypropylene are crucial to this industry.

On the ground, flexible ducting is a major part of temporary structures used in aviation––especially in the military. Environmental Control Units, or ECUs, require flexible ducting to function properly. To maintain heating, cooling or humidity control, flexible ducting allows ECUs to be used in multiple applications: mobile hospitals, weapons storage, housing aircrafts or communications compounds.

Finally, military combination air and power carts require flexible ducting to provide their cooling capabilities while still being compact and portable.
